Your last 10 days

Your 224 predicted three digit score correlates with a two digit score of 94. See this thread
http://www.usmle-forums.com/recomme...smle-two-digit-versus-three-digit-scores.html

So you are in a very good shape. Don't let your anxiety underpin your weeks and months of preparation.

Utilize the next 10 days by reviewing First Aid if you have done it before. Do few more blocks. And you can also do another NBME Form just to make sure.

You have to rectify you sleeping pattern right now. Wake up at 6 AM and sleep as early as you can.

Eat very well. Take vitamins and do not be in contact with sick persons.

The last day of your prep you should not read at all, throw all books and relax. Go for a walk if the weather allows. Shave, swim or shower.

This is your peak and you have done very well so far it's just few more days and you'll earn the profits of your hard work.
